The Browning Invector-DS 16 Gauge Light Full Extended choke tube in stainless steel is a precision shot-shaping tool for 16-gauge shotgunners who want to tighten their patterns without breaking the bank or adding excess weight. Browning's Invector-DS platform is purpose-built for modern shotguns that accept this system, offering hunters and competitive shooters a straightforward way to dial in constriction for specific game and distance.

This Light Full choke delivers a Full-constriction pattern—the tightest standard choke option—in an extended tube design that makes removal and installation intuitive. The stainless steel construction resists corrosion from moisture and salt air, holding up through years of truck racks, creek crossings, and seaside hunts. Extended chokes also let you keep your hands and tools further from the shotgun's muzzle, reducing fiddling in the field and improving leverage during swaps.

Whether you're reaching out on late-season doves, wrapping up a pheasant season, or pattern-testing loads before competition, a Full choke in stainless is a no-nonsense workhorse. It pairs with any 16-gauge shotgun built for Invector-DS tubes, and its neutral profile won't disrupt your gun's handling or balance.

Frequently Asked Questions

What shotguns will this choke tube fit?

The Invector-DS system is found on Browning and certain other manufacturers' 16-gauge shotguns. Check your owner's manual or the markings on your gun's choke threads to confirm compatibility before purchase.

What pattern should I expect from a Light Full choke?

A Light Full choke delivers tight, concentrated shot patterns suitable for longer-range shooting. It's ideal for distant targets where you need pellet density and reduced spread.

Is stainless steel worth the extra durability?

Stainless steel resists rust and corrosion better than blued steel, making it a solid choice if you hunt in wet climates, salt air, or plan to store your shotgun for extended periods without frequent maintenance.

How do I remove and install this choke tube?

Invector-DS tubes screw directly into the shotgun's muzzle. Use the removal tool or a choke wrench to unscrew the old tube, then hand-tighten the new one until snug. The extended design provides more grip surface for easier handling.
